CITY, DEVELOPER FINALIZE NEGOTIATION TERMS FOR SPORTS ARENA SITE

San Diego Union Tribune


The city of San Diego and development team Midway Rising have cemented an agreement to negotiate the lease and redevelopment of the city’s 48-acre sports arena site in the Midway District.

A SURPRISING FIND IN RETAIL MALLS

Globe St.


The general assumption in retail that’s been building, part of the “retail apocalypse,” as Placer.ai notes in a new report, is the oversupply of malls in the US. Something’s got to give, and it will be the secondary tier of properties. But a growing number of brands looking for space as the “safe” locations has opened a possibility that B-tier malls could potentially see a resurgence.
